State Orders Cleanup Costs from Nippon Dynawave | Vancouver News

Nippon Dynawave is on the hook for cleanup costs after a deadly chemical spill in Longview, as state officials move to recover expenses for emergency response, lab fees, and worker travel. With the last 12,000 gallons of caustic white liquor removed from the “G tank,” demolition is now possible — though air monitoring continues until the tank is gone. While water testing has paused, air quality checks remain active, with zero hydrogen sulfide detected so far. The U.S. Chemical Safety Board plans a delayed but critical report by fall, aiming to prevent future disasters in the paper industry, while Washington’s labor department races to finish its worker safety probe by November 22.
